Monster Hunter Wilds Trailer Highlights the Great Sword

Block heavy hits and dish out charged slashes, or take advantage of a new rising slash to knock back an aggressive monster.

Gamescom Opening Night Live is coming up on August 20th, and that’s likely where Capcom will drop its next trailer for Monster Hunter Wilds. In the meantime, it’s begun highlighting each weapon type in the game, starting with the Great Sword. Slow but hard-hitting, it’s a weapon for hit-and-run tactics and big damage numbers.

The Great Sword’s hallmark is its charged slashes, which leave the user vulnerable for a moment. However, successfully landing one can lead to two additional stages of charged slashes. The weapon is also ideal for guarding against attacks, and you can cancel charged slashes with a shoulder tackle (which also grants damage reduction).

Wilds introduces is a powerful upward slash which can knock a monster down, leading to two follow-up slices. Focus Mode allows for dragging the blade across a monster, dealing damage to multiple wounds, and there’s also a cool moment when blocking a strike.

Monster Hunter Wilds is out next year for Xbox Series X/S, PS5, and PC. Check out Capcom’s other recent trailers or our feature for more details.
